AC Milan's last summer transfer window was Luka Jovic who joined the club on a free transfer in order to reinforce the striker's Position in Stefano Pioli's lineup. The starter is Olivier Giroud, but the Serbian wants to challenge his French teammate.
According to what is reported by Tuttosport in this morning's print edition, the former Real Madrid player is very motivated and has landed in the Rossoneri with the aim to redeem his career. He had a difficult last season with Fiorentina, despite having scored 13 goals.
As far as Jovic is concerned, he has turned the page and wants to help his new club and team by doing well on the pitch and contributing with goals.
